The rosehip for this tea should be dark, almost brown, with a slight shade of red. And it should not be ground under any circumstances, otherwise small hairs from the berry grains will end up in the tea.

Put rose hips in a thermos, pour hot water over them, and let steep for at least four hours, preferably overnight.

Pour the prepared drink into a cup, add honey, stir, and garnish with a slice of orange.
